Packaging compliance costs are becoming a more visible consideration in procurement decisions across the meat-processing industry. PackUK published packaging base fees in June 2025 for material placed on the United Kingdom market during the first reporting year. Those fees give obligated producers a measurable cost signal that brings minor meat packaging components into formal material reviews. Meat processors therefore approve a liner once trials confirm purge control and documented material classification on the intended packing line.
Protein output changes the scale and operating conditions under which recyclable packaging liners must earn approval across national meat programs. OECD and FAO reported in July 2025 that global meat production reached 365 million tonnes during 2024. Brazil expanded production across its major meat categories and requires liners suited to export-scale chilled distribution. Germany and the United Kingdom apply clearer recyclability tests while Japan combines cautious specification changes with varied municipal collection routes. Commercial entry depends on local recovery evidence that remains credible without weakening leak control during chilled distribution.

What makes uncoated paper liners central to the product type category?

Uncoated paper suits interleaving and moderate purge loads across standardized fresh food packaging formats that avoid sustained free-liquid exposure during chilled distribution. Its familiar paper packaging route simplifies material classification but longer dwell times and tray pressure can reduce wet strength during handling and removal.

How does virgin fiber influence selection within the material category?
Virgin fiber provides controlled formation and cleanliness for direct food packaging contact during repeated processor qualification programs across several high-volume production sites with varied tray programs. Its consistent furnish lets packaging engineers adjust capillary uptake without relying on a heavier synthetic superabsorbent core during production on approved converting equipment.

How do meat processors evaluate leak control?
Leak control protects seal areas and retail presentation during chilled distribution as free liquid increases rework and label failures across repeated high-volume retail programs. Dry absorbency cannot establish suitability since a pad may release captured liquid under tray pressure during commercial handling and pack opening across repeated distribution cycles.

The EU Packaging and Packaging Waste Regulation entered into force in February 2025 and generally applies from August 2026. Recyclability becomes a design requirement for barrier packaging components instead of a voluntary material preference. Processors need liner composition records that support recovery claims without weakening purge control during normal production.
Food contamination remains the main restraint since compatible construction does not guarantee collection following contact with purge. The USA Food and Drug Administration stated in May 2025 that authorizations apply to defined uses and migration conditions. Changed coatings or cores extend qualification by altering exposure conditions and disposal claims on finished packs.
Commercial opportunity centers on constructions tested for retention and local recovery within the complete sustainable packaging format. Paper liners need wet strength without repulping losses while mono PE - PP requires an accepted collection route. Joint development connects material evidence with production trials and disposal guidance for specific processor programs.

Key Developments in the Recyclable Meat Liners Market
- In July 2026, MAGIC S.p.A. commissioned ANDRITZ to supply an airlaid food-pad line for first-quarter 2027 startup that targets rapid uptake and low rewetting in meat packaging.
- In June 2025, Cellcomb AB acquired Fatex and combined Swedish and Finnish production for a wider cellulose-based range serving food-industry and healthcare qualification programs.
- In March 2025, Cellcomb AB gained European home-and-garden compost certification for its four-side-sealed cellulose food pad and added a documented end-of-life route following purge exposure.
